  1. Qualitative Adjective

    optical

    Definitions

    1. relating to or using sight

    Examples

    • « ocular inspection »
    • « an optical illusion »
    • « visual powers »
    • « visual navigation »
  2. 2. of or relating to or involving light or optics

    Examples

    • « optical supplies »
  3. 3. of or relating to or resembling the eye

    Examples

    • « ocular muscles »
    • « an ocular organ »
    • « ocular diseases »
    • « the optic (or optical) axis of the eye »
    • « an ocular spot is a pigmented organ or part believed to be sensitive to light »
